## Changelog — StreamForge 2.4

Rotated release signing keys alongside the websocket compression change. We enabled permessage-deflate on the Brackenhall relay; CPU rose ~8% but bandwidth dropped 40%, acceptable per last week's sync. Old key revoked; all relay builds after today must verify against the new one, shown here.

signing key of bagap-yawep = bky13_TbfT6ZMUoGJo2

The Fuelgrid fleet fuel-usage report endpoint returns aggregated consumption per vehicle over a configurable window, with totals rounded to two decimals and anomalies flagged by the Burnrate detector. Responses are read-only and contain no driver identities. Rate limits apply per credential at sixty requests per minute. Access to the internal reporting gateway requires the key shown directly below.

app token of bawep-hafog = kto7_vwrmnlx

## Break-Glass: Bigdiff Emergency Access

If you're on call and Bigdiff — our diff viewer for monster files — falls over during an incident, you can bypass SSO and hit the maintenance endpoint directly. This is break-glass only: it skips audit-friendly auth, so file a follow-up ticket the moment you're done. The maintenance endpoint renders diffs in degraded streaming mode, which is ugly but functional. To authenticate at the break-glass prompt, supply the recovery passphrase shown below.

vault phrase of bagaf-kajeg = jorath-feniel-briir-siliel-ralix

**Ticket: Report builder sort flakiness + expired creds**

Hey on-call — the Ledgerloom report builder started producing unstable sort orders after the Tarnwick cache creds expired last night. Looks like the fallback path skips the stable-sort shim entirely. Fix is to restore access and redeploy. I've already minted a fresh key for the Tarnwick service; it's right below.

gateway credential: kto23_LX9A4ys6i4nzHtpOLNLodKK